The attainment gap in Scottish education—highlighted by the fact that only 65% of 2023-24 school leavers from the most deprived areas achieved a National 5 pass, compared to 91% from the least deprived—requires innovative solutions.
Archaeology Scotland's Attainment through Archaeology (AtA) programme offers just that. Through practical archaeology, AtA helps young people from disadvantaged backgrounds develop vital transferable skills, enhance self-confidence, and improve their educational outcomes and overall health and well-being.
